When using the MI interpreter, if someone was to attach to a ROCm
process which has active GPU waves, GDB would issue a segfault as
follows:

The issue comes from using a non-initialized pointer in mi_on_resume_1:
if (!mi->running_result_record_printed && mi->mi_proceeded)
{
gdb_printf (mi->raw_stdout, "%s^running\n",
mi->current_token ? mi->current_token : "");
}
In this instance, "mi->current_token" has an uninitialized value. This is a
regression introduced by:
commit def2803789
Date: Wed Sep 6 11:02:00 2023 -0400
gdb/mi: make current_token a field of mi_interp
Before this patch, current_token was a global implicitly 0-initialized. Since
it is now a class field, it is not 0-initialized by default anymore. This
patch changes this.
